Horse Named Junior Missing from Monkton Farm

Farm owner Gloria Finglass said Junior has been missing for four days.

A horse who was kept at a Monkton farm near Kingsdene Nursery and Marathon Farm has been missing since Oct. 16, according to farm owner Gloria Finglass.

Junior, a 6-year-old quarter horse, belongs to Finglass's niece Kelly Strucko, 15. 

Finglass said Junior may have escaped after a tree fell on a fence at the property on Sunday, leaving an opening.
